WebIncentive spirometry. Incentive spirometers are mechanical devices introduced in an attempt to reduce postoperative pulmonary complications. The patient takes a slow deep breath in, with his lips sealed around the mouthpiece (See Fig. below) and is motivated by visual feedback, for example a ball rising to a pre-set marker. WebAn incentive spirometer is a different type of medical device that’s good for your lungs. It’s a simple plastic device that you can use at home. It helps your lungs expand and get stronger.
